German
Etymology 1
Borrowed from Late Latin ēditor.
Pronunciation
Noun
Editor m (mixed, genitive Editors, plural Editoren, feminine Editorin)
- (publishing) editor (person at a newspaper, publisher or similar institution who edits stories)
- Synonyms: Herausgeber, Redakteur, (Swiss) Redaktor

Etymology 2
Pronunciation
Noun
Editor m (mixed, genitive Editors, plural Editoren)
- (computing) text editor (program which allows a user to edit the contents of a text file, usually in an interactive way with immediate visual feedback)
- Synonym: Texteditor
